English : English for Speakers of Arabic Reviewor one of the best. I`m an English teacher, and 4 lessons a week is not enough . so, I gave this for some of my student`s and I think it`s very good for begginers.I gave it 4 for 4 issues:
1-It`s a little bit boring for teenagers.
2-there is no written material. many of my student know how to say words or phrases but they can`t read or write the same words if I asked them to.
3-Its high price. we are not in the 70`s. so, why would any one buy it if he can find similar or the same product for free on the internet.
4-I`m studying French now and I think pimsleur English for arabic speakers is not as good as pimsleur french .

This course teaches Standard American English as spoken in the US. Instruction is in Arabic.Comprehensive ESL Arabic includes 30 lessons of essential grammar and vocabulary -- 16 hours of real-life spoken practice sessions -- plus an introduction to reading. Upon completion of this program, you will have functional spoken proficiency with the most-frequently-used vocabulary and grammatical structures. You will be able to: initiate and maintain face-to-face conversations,deal with every day situations -- ask for information, directions, and give basic information about yourself and family,communicate basic information on informal topics and participate in casual conversations,avoid basic cultural errors and handle minimum courtesy and travel requirements,satisfy personal needs and limited social demands,establish rapport with strangers in foreign countries,begin reading and sounding out items with native-like pronunciation.
